Choosing Your Faucet
You should consider several factors when selecting the right faucet for your kitchen, from compatibility and practical features to style and finishes. We recommend balancing your needs and the characteristics of your sink to find an option that is both functional and matches your taste.
Measure and Check Compatibility
The first step to finding a quality faucet begins in your kitchen. Take accurate measurements of your sink, including:
- Sink holes: Count the holes in your sink and their spacing to match faucet types.
- Clearance: Measure the space above the sink for high-arc or pull-down spouts and ensure there is sufficient room behind for handles.
- Sink size: Check the space around your sink for faucet height and reach.
Choose a Model With or Without a Sprayer
Faucet sprayers offer a more flexible, powerful and controlled spray of water that makes some tasks easier and efficient. Some faucets are designed with different spray patterns like stream, shower or pulse and a movable hose.
Kitchen faucets with sprayers feature convenient pull-down or pull-out options integrated in their design. They set the modern standard for functionality in cleaning large pots, rinsing the sink and prepping food. On the other hand, kitchen faucets without sprayers have a clean, minimalist look. This is ideal for smaller sinks, bar sinks or kitchens that already use a separate side-sprayer.
The right choice will depend on your personal preference, sink configuration and how you typically use your kitchen sink. Consider your daily routine as well. If you often need to rinse large items under a fixed faucet, a sprayer is a practical upgrade. If you value a clean, simple look and only use your sink for basic tasks, a faucet without a sprayer will work for you.
Determine Spout Style and Handle Configuration
Choosing the spout style of your faucet means striking a balance between aesthetics and function. You should consider the height, how far it extends to the drain and the configuration for optimal usability and minimal splashing. For example, a gooseneck model is higher and great for filling tall pots, while a low-arc spout is best for splash control.
The handle configuration on your new faucet must be compatible with your sink's hole configuration. Single-handle faucets offer easy temperature and flow control, while two-handle models provide precise adjustments for hot and cold water.
